Samsung Biologics Joins DCAT Week 2026 in New York to Boost Global Contracting
Samsung Biologics said March 25 it is taking part in DCAT Week 2026, being held March 23-26 (local time) in New York, to step up global contract-winning efforts. With more than 130 years of history, DCAT Week is a global pharmaceutical and biotech networking event that began in 1890 under the New York Chamber of Commerce. 'A Man Living With the King' Tops 15 Million Tickets, Ranks No. 3 All Time in Korea
The film ‘A Man Living With the King’ has surpassed 15 million admissions in South Korea, reaching the milestone 50 days after its release. Distributor Showbox said Wednesday that the movie had topped 15 million cumulative viewers as of Wednesday afternoon. It reached 10 million admissions on its 31st day in theaters after opening Feb. 4, then hit 14 million on day 45 before adding another 1 million in just five days. South Korea Game Industry Revenue Tops 23.85 Trillion Won, Ranks No. 4 Globally
South Korea’s game industry continued to grow in 2024, with revenue topping 23.85 trillion won, according to a government-backed report released Tuesday. The Ministry of Culture, Sports and Tourism and the Korea Creative Content Agency said in the “2025 Korea Game White Paper” that 2024 domestic game-industry revenue totaled 23.8515 trillion won, up 3.9% from a year earlier. Exports came to $8.50346 billion (about 11.5985 trillion won), a 1.3% increase year over year, the report said.

Survey: 7 in 10 South Korean fintech firms operate without e-finance registration
South Korea’s payment gateway (PG) industry is expanding rapidly, but about seven in 10 fintech companies are operating without registering as an electronic financial business, a new survey found. Despite tighter oversight of PG operators, many firms still take part in payment functions outside the regulatory system, raising concerns about blind spots in supervision.
